Ribald meaning
Ribald is an intriguing word that can add a touch of humor and playfulness to your sentences. Derived from the Old French word "ribaut," meaning a dissolute or licentious person, ribald has evolved to describe something that is vulgar, lewd, or irreverent in a humorous or mocking way.
